TWO PORCELAIN SOUP PLATES FROM THE ST. ANDREW AND ST. GEORGE ORDER SERVICES
by the Gardner factory, St. Petersburg, circa 1780
The first plate, with undulating gilt border decorated in the center with the Star of St. Andrew, the rim designed with the collar of the Order, marked under the base; the second, with undulating gilt border, the center painted with the Order of St. George, the yellow-orange and black ribbon intertwined with a laurel garland around the rim with the badge of the order at one side, marked under the base
first plate: 9.6in. (24.8cm.); second plate: 9in. (22.9cm.) diam. (2)
